The Core Mechanics of Chicken Road Gameplay
At its heart, ‘chicken road’ is a game about risk assessment and precise timing. Players control the chicken’s movement, typically using tap or click inputs to move the chicken forward across the road. The key is to identify gaps in the oncoming traffic and to time your movements accordingly. The speed of the vehicles often increases as the game progresses, creating a more challenging and intense experience. Mastering this mechanic requires a keen eye, fast reflexes, and a bit of anticipation. Successfully navigating the traffic becomes increasingly demanding, but therefore more rewarding.
Beyond the fundamental movement, many versions of the game incorporate additional elements like power-ups, varying road layouts, and obstacles. Some power-ups might temporarily slow down traffic, allowing for easier crossings, while others might introduce multiple chickens to manage simultaneously. These additions help to maintain player engagement and provide a fresh twist on the core gameplay.
Strategic positioning is crucial. Don’t rush into traffic blindly. Scan the road, identify the largest gaps, and wait for the opportune moment to make your move. Remember, patience can be just as important as quick reflexes. A measured approach often yields better results than a frantic dash. Understanding traffic patterns is also essential. Observe how vehicles move. Do they follow a consistent rhythm or do they behave more unpredictably?

Variations and Modern Adaptations
While the core concept of ‘chicken road’ remains remarkably consistent, numerous variations and modern adaptations have emerged over the years. Developers have experimented with different visual styles, adding humorous themes and charming characters. Some versions introduce new obstacles, like moving platforms or environmental hazards, adding an extra layer of challenge. These variations keep the game fresh and appealing to a wider audience.
Many modern adaptations have also incorporated social features, allowing players to compete against each other for high scores and share their achievements with friends. Leaderboards and online challenges add a competitive element, driving players to continuously improve their skills. This aspect enhances the game’s replay value. It introduces a competitive element.
Mobile platforms have been instrumental in the resurgence of ‘chicken road’ style games. The touch-screen controls are ideally suited to the game’s simple mechanics, and the portability of mobile devices makes it easy to play on the go. Today, you can find countless versions of ‘chicken road’ available for download on both iOS and Android devices.
